The covers are lightly faded at the top edge and the top corners are a bit bumped. "Effigy Tumuli, dedicated in 1985, has been described as 'the most ambitious outdoor sculpture since Mt. Rushmore was completed in 1941.' ARTnews said, 'Effigy Tumuli may well turn out to be one of the country's most successful public sculptures.' It is the world of Michael Heizer, an artist who left New York for the deserts of the American West where, beginning in the late 1960s, he created monumental constructions out of the earth".
